What's the best time of year to book my B&B in Pukewharariki?
When you're planning your stay in Pukewharariki, be sure to take into account the year-round temperatures. The hottest months are usually February and January with an average temp of 67°F, while the coldest months are July and August with an average of 56°F. Average annual precipitation for Pukewharariki is 52 inches.
What is there to do in Pukewharariki?
Spend some time exploring Hokianga Harbour and Lake Omapere if you're hoping to see some of the area's natural features. You might check out Maungataniwha Range if you have time to see more of the area.
How can I get to and around Pukewharariki?
You can map out your trip in and around Pukewharariki ahead of time with these transportation options. Fly into Kerikeri (KKE-Bay of Islands), which is located 13.8 mi (22.2 km) from the heart of the city. If you'd like to venture out around the area, you may want to rent a car for your trip.
